The Government of National Capital Territory of Delhi (Amendment) Bill, 2021, which was introduced by the Centre in parliament on Monday, ostensibly with the objective of giving a proper interpretation to the Supreme Court ruling of 2018, has been criticised by the ruling Aam Aadmi Party in Delhi as an attempt to curtail the powers of the elected government. Meanwhile, experts have cautioned that it could face constitutional and legal hurdles as it also does away with various powers of the Delhi assembly committees.

Difference between objectives and reality

Though the objective of the Bill states that it will promote harmonious relations between the legislature and the executive, and further define the responsibilities of the elected government and the LG, in line with the constitutional scheme of governance of National Capital Territory of Delhi, as interpreted by the Honble Supreme Court, it is being widely felt that it would only increase friction between the elected government and the Centre, that governs Delhi through the L-G.

 

A major reason behind this is that the amendment notes that the opinion of the L-G will have to be sought on every decision by the ministers. This, officials insist, will only result in delay in projects and schemes, as a lot of files will have to be sent to the L-G since a large number of decisions are taken by the ministers on all kinds of issues on a daily basis.
